Technical field
The utility model relates to biomass catalyzing feeding technique field, specially a kind of biomass catalyzing feeding device.
Background technique
Currently, energy and environmental problem has become world's focus problem, it restricts existence and the hair of society of the mankind Exhibition.As the increasingly depleted and problem of environmental pollution of fossil energy is on the rise, exploitation clean renewable resources are had become tightly Urgent project.And biomass energy is increasingly subject to as the renewable and clean energy resource that uniquely can be stored and transport, research and application Global attention.Biomass catalyzing can be converted into the fuel gas such as methane, hydrogen, carbon monoxide, and gas can be wide It is general to apply in family's cooking, heating, the energy is provided for factory.In the prior art, feeding device is directly that raw material is direct mostly Investment reacting furnace is reacted, and since the material of investment is of different sizes, reaction speed can not be determined, and the dispensing effect of raw material is not It is good.

Fig. 1-5 is please referred to, the utility model provides a kind of technical solution: a kind of biomass catalyzing feeding device, including into Expects pipe 2 and mounting rack 1,2 top of feed pipe are fixedly connected with mounting rack 1, and 2 middle part of sliding channel of feed pipe is equipped with motor 13, the shaft 3 of the motor 13 is through to 2 inner cavity of feed pipe, and the shaft 3 of 2 lumen portion of feed pipe is fixedly connected with T-type Raw material can be carried out pulverization process, make the excellent catalytic effect of raw material, the T-type by crushing knife 4 by the way that T-type crushing knife 4 is arranged Filter screen 5 is provided with below crushing knife 4, the filter screen 5 and the distance between T-type crushing knife 4 are smaller, by the way that filter screen is arranged 5, the raw material not crushed completely can be intercepted, and continue to be crushed by T-type crushing knife 4,2 bottom of feed pipe is provided with out Material mouth 6,1 bottom slide track of mounting rack are connected with pulp-collecting box 7, and 7 two sides of pulp-collecting box are provided with sliding slot 14, the mounting rack 1 bottom is fixedly connected with the sliding block 8 to match with sliding slot 14, and the sliding block 8 is 15cm-25cm longer than sliding slot 14, can make splicing Box 7 travels forward along sliding block 8, and baffle 9 is made to completely disengage 1 bottom plate of mounting rack, and the pulp-collecting box 7 is corresponding with 6 position of discharge port, And the discharge port 6 is 15cm-20cm smaller than pulp-collecting box 7, so that smashed raw material is fallen completely within pulp-collecting box 7, will not leak out, 7 bottom of pulp-collecting box is movably installed with baffle 9, and the pulp-collecting box 7 is rotatablely connected with baffle 9 by short axle, and short axle is arranged It can make electricity by the way that pulp-collecting box 7 and baffle 9 to be rotatablely connected by short axle in the underface of inclined plate 12 and 7 intersection of pulp-collecting box When dynamic telescopic rod 11 releases pulp-collecting box 7, baffle 9 is automatically opened due to not having bottom to support, and is automatically drained out raw material, described 7 inner cavity of pulp-collecting box is provided with inclined plate 12 far from the side of baffle 9, by the way that inclined plate 12 is arranged, raw material can be made to fall into pulp-collecting box 7 Side facilitates dispensing, and the mounting rack 1 is equipped with electric telescopic rod 11 close to the side of inclined plate 12, and electric telescopic rod 11 passes through outer It connects power supply to be powered, by the way that electric telescopic rod 11 is arranged, the 11 model JINGE-1601 of electric telescopic rod can be automatic Raw material is launched, can be retracted pulp-collecting box 7 by shrinking, 11 elongation end of electric telescopic rod is fixedly connected with splicing The lower rotation of box 7,1 opening of frame is connected with roller bearing 10, by the way that roller bearing 10 is arranged, when facilitating the recycling of pulp-collecting box 7, Reduce the friction with 1 bottom of mounting rack.
Working principle: when in use, the raw material for needing to launch is put into feed pipe 2, the raw material of investment is by T-type crushing knife 4 It crushes, the raw material of crushing is filtered by filter screen 5, and the raw material of bulky grain is intercepted to be continued to be crushed by T-type crushing knife 4, directly Pulp-collecting box 7 is fallen into discharge port 6 can be passed through by filter screen 5, smashed raw material, when pulp-collecting box 7 is filled, starts electronic stretches Contracting bar 11, the stretching of electric telescopic rod 11 release pulp-collecting box 7 along sliding block 8, and the baffle 9 of 7 bottom of pulp-collecting box after release is due to outstanding Empty and opens, raw material discharge, electric telescopic rod 11 is shunk, and pulp-collecting box 7 is retracted, and when pulp-collecting box 7 retracts, baffle 9 is by roller bearing 10 withdraw, and baffle 7 comes back to original position, and pulp-collecting box 7 at this time becomes completely, and repetitive operation terminates until feeding intake, behaviour It completes.
